华为鸿蒙系统升级:深度解析其操作系统内核及生态构建304


华为升级支持鸿蒙系统,这一举动不仅是简单的软件更新,更是其在操作系统领域长期战略布局的重要一步。 要理解这一事件的深远影响,我们需要深入探讨鸿蒙系统的核心技术、架构设计以及其生态系统建设的策略。这篇文章将从操作系统的专业角度,剖析鸿蒙系统升级背后的技术细节和市场战略。

首先,鸿蒙系统并非一个简单的安卓套壳。虽然早期版本在部分应用兼容性上借鉴了安卓的优势,但其核心架构与安卓有着本质区别。鸿蒙采用的是基于微内核的分布式架构,这与安卓的宏内核架构形成了鲜明对比。宏内核架构将所有系统服务运行在同一个内核空间,安全性相对较低,一旦某个服务崩溃,可能导致整个系统崩溃。而微内核架构则将系统服务拆分成多个独立的微内核,每个微内核运行在独立的地址空间,即使某个服务崩溃,也不会影响其他服务,从而提升了系统的稳定性和安全性。鸿蒙的微内核设计,使其在物联网设备和嵌入式系统中具有显著优势,能够应对资源受限的环境,并提供更可靠的服务。

鸿蒙的分布式能力是其另一个核心竞争力。 它能够将多个设备无缝连接成一个超级终端,实现资源共享和协同工作。例如,用户可以在手机上开始编辑文档,然后无缝切换到平板电脑继续编辑,甚至可以将手机屏幕投射到电视上进行演示。这种分布式能力并非简单的设备互联,而是底层操作系统架构赋予的功能。鸿蒙通过统一的分布式软总线、分布式数据管理、分布式任务调度等技术,实现了不同设备之间的透明互联和协同工作,这在其他操作系统中并不常见,也构成了其重要的技术壁垒。

鸿蒙系统的升级,也体现在其对不同设备类型的支持上。 从智能手机、平板电脑、智能手表到智能家居设备,甚至汽车,鸿蒙系统都能够提供适配的版本。 这得益于其可裁剪的架构设计。 鸿蒙系统并非一个“一刀切”的操作系统,它可以根据不同设备的硬件资源和功能需求,裁剪出不同大小的操作系统版本,从而满足各种设备的运行需求。这种可裁剪性不仅降低了开发成本,也提升了系统的效率和兼容性。

然而,鸿蒙系统也面临着一些挑战。首先是生态系统的建设。虽然华为积极吸引开发者加入鸿蒙生态,但与安卓和iOS相比,其应用数量和质量还有待提升。 一个强大的操作系统生态需要大量的应用支持,才能吸引用户,而应用的开发则需要时间和投入。华为需要持续投入资源,吸引更多开发者加入鸿蒙生态,并提供更完善的开发工具和支持。

其次是国际化进程。 鸿蒙系统虽然在国内市场取得了一定的成功,但在国际市场上的影响力仍然有限。 这与谷歌的安卓系统和苹果的iOS系统相比,存在一定的差距。 华为需要进一步拓展国际市场,提升鸿蒙系统在全球范围内的知名度和用户接受度。

此外,安全性也是一个重要的考量因素。 任何操作系统都可能面临安全风险,鸿蒙系统也不例外。 华为需要不断加强系统的安全性,及时修复漏洞,并采取有效的安全措施,以保护用户的数据和隐私。 这需要持续的投入和更新迭代。

从操作系统的角度来看,鸿蒙系统升级代表着华为在操作系统领域的持续创新和投入。 其微内核架构、分布式能力和可裁剪性等技术优势,使其在物联网时代具有巨大的潜力。 然而,生态建设、国际化进程和安全性等挑战依然存在。 华为能否克服这些挑战,最终在操作系统领域占据一席之地,还需要时间来检验。 此次升级,无疑是华为鸿蒙系统发展道路上一个重要的里程碑,也预示着未来操作系统竞争格局的变化。

最后,值得一提的是,华为在鸿蒙系统的开发中也注重开源和开放合作。 这有助于吸引更多开发者参与到鸿蒙生态的建设中,并推动鸿蒙系统的不断完善和发展。 开源的理念也能够促进技术交流和创新,最终推动整个操作系统行业的进步。

总而言之,华为升级支持鸿蒙系统,是一个复杂且多层面的事件,涵盖了技术创新、市场战略、生态建设以及国际竞争等多个方面。 只有深入理解其操作系统内核的技术特点和市场策略,才能更好地评估其未来发展前景。

2025-03-19


上一篇:Android 9.0系统剪贴板访问与安全机制详解

下一篇:鸿蒙操作系统:成熟度分析及未来发展方向